Slow Checkout from Jumbo

This came across my Facebook feed over the holiday time, and it honestly makes a lot of sense. The original post is a photo from 2022, talking about how "Jumbo" (a Dutch chain of supermarkets) introduced "Slow Checkouts" for those who "enjoy chatting while paying for their goods".

Officially, the company has dubbed these lanes "Chat Checkout", and has now expanded that to over 100 of their stores, in an attempt to reach the "aging" population in their country.
